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ect of the proposal on the living conditions of the occupants of neighbouring dwellings with particular regard to noise, disturbance and dust
What decided it
The cumulative impact of noise arising from the proposed B2 activities across the whole site on neighbouring residential properties had not been adequately assessed with sufficiently up-to-date evidence, and the Inspector's observations during the site visit confirmed significant noise generation from the proposed activities.
